Abstract

This bachelor´s work is concerned with detection of important anatomical eye features in digital ophthalmological images. It is concretely the optic disc, macula and blood vessels. This work describes a complete process from taking a picture of retinal images, its preprocessing to the final detection of above-mentioned objects. There are a lot of methods which are concerned with this issue. Some of them have been a partial model for finishing this work. The theoretical part contains among other things a lot of pictures which illustrates and explains this issue. The content of the practical part is the creation of the computer program in the interactive programming environment MATLAB R2012a. The created algorithm is instrumental in automatic detection of features in digital fundus images. The graphical user interface is also created for it.
